Default Restoring Holster - Value Thereof

I recently bought an Imperial rig with a holster which appears to have been with the gun since WW-I. The holster is in good physical condition, but the surface/finish is pretty rough.

I would like to improve the appearance and protect the leather from further deterioration, BUT I don't want to do anything which would decrease the value of the holster or negatively affect the collectability thereof.

In the opinion of other collectors, would any kind of restoration degrade the value in a manner analogous to that when a Luger is reblued?
